Transaction 43c2818c809f92bbb148d3273f8c7748b6c6912ce7a55f12ea591ad4c3f401bf

1 Input
2 Outputs
  • 43c2818c809f92bbb148d3273f8c7748b6c6912ce7a55f12ea591ad4c3f401bf:0
  • value  28384270
    address  1DUxubj8mcZf6q8ybqN8tLvVansoEctpsR
  • 43c2818c809f92bbb148d3273f8c7748b6c6912ce7a55f12ea591ad4c3f401bf:1
  • value  8350970
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n